Helen Luetta Siems Slingerland

Posted on April 2, 2009 by Staff

Helen L. Slingerland, 80, entered into Glory of her Lord on March, 2009. She died from complications following surgery after gallantly fighting and surviving cancer for ten years. She was born March 20, 1929 in Roselle, IL to Henry Siems and Emma Lichthardt Siems. She is predeceased by her loving husband, Walter R. Slingerland, Jr.

She is survived by her daughters, Mary Helen Owens of Mebane and Lisa Slingerland Wallis of Shanghai, China; sons-in-law, Robert E. Owens and Mark S. Wallis; grandchildren, Sarah K. Owens, Mark S. Wallis II and Andrew W. Wallis.

A memorial service will be held at 10 a.m. on Saturday, April 4, 2009 at Holy Trinity Lutheran Worship Center, 227 E. Rosemary St., Chapel Hill, 27514. Rev. David Hood will officiate. Interment will be in Schaumburg, IL at St. Peter Lutheran Church cemetery.

Helen and Walter lived in Schaumburg, IL until retiring to Ft. Myers Beach and Naples, FL. They relocated to The Cedars of Chapel Hill in 2004.
The family expresses deepest gratitude and appreciation to the Duke University Hospital doctors, nurses and staff for their compassionate and diligent care.

In lieu of flowers, memorials may be given to the Holy Trinity Lutheran Church. Arrangements by Walkers Funeral Home, (919) 942-3861.
